OUR STORY
After so many good times and great adventures, it's time for us to say
goodbye to our home for five of the last nine years. We have
entrusted this beautiful boat with our lives and she has proven over and over
that we made the right choice when we first saw her in Sausalito.
Seasilk is equipped to be sailed single-handed, but is perfect for
2 couples or a family of 4. With a fully enclosed cockpit, she is equipped for both cold and warm weather sailing
and is very comfortable as a live-aboard. This makes her the perfect choice for a family whose plans will evolve.
The
blue-ocean-voyager Seasilk
has conveyed us safely from San Francisco to San Diego and several trips
to Catalina. She has weathered the high winds of South San Francisco
and one hurricane with grace, and she has provided us with two wonderful
cruising vacations of 6 and 9 months to the far reaches of the Mexican
west coast. We've had so many friends enjoy her spacious accommodations
and sailing style. With the help of many of those
friends, she won us the coveted Ward Cleveland Memorial award at Opening Day
2009 in San Francisco. She has also won a couple of races including her
division in the 2010 Baja Ha Ha, but we don't often race our
house. We hope her next owner will enjoy her even half as much as we
have. Craig & Sue
